Notophthalmus meridionalis
They are typically olive green with numerous black spots and a yellow belly. They have smooth skin, and a vertically flattened tail to help them propel through the water.
They are found in Northern Mexico and South Texas, they prefer large, shallow bodies of water with lots of vegetation. They are fully aquatic.
